Data Upload and Download to Cloud Symbol

Oracle Noon (Oracle Application Express) is a web-based software evolution system that runs on an Oracle Database. It comes equally standard with all Oracle Database editions and Oracle Autonomous Database service and, naturally, is fully supported.

In other words, Oracle APEX is a low-lawmaking development platform for building scalable and secure enterprise apps that solve real bug and provide immediate value. And so, you can deploy those apps anywhere. Y'all won't need to be an proficient in a vast assortment of technologies to deliver excellent solutions.

Democratic Database Service does not crave yous to install annihilation to start using APEX. Later on you provision an Autonomous Database, the APEX platform is also installed and ready to utilise.

The electric current tutorial will explain how to create an awarding to Upload and Download files. The data is hosted in the BLOB column of the Democratic Database.

Admission Oracle Apex Platform

This tutorial assumes that y'all have already possessed some basic knowledge of Oracle Democratic Data Warehouse (ADW). You may refer to the article nearly provisioning an Oracle Autonomous Database to refresh your knowledge.

At present, you need to access the Oracle Cloud Infrastructure Console (OCI) and go to the provisioned Autonomous Database instance:

Access APEX Platform

Click on Service Console – yous will get to the Service Console page where the ADMIN user of Autonomous Database can monitor the database system and execute authoritative tasks.

Navigate to Development . Oracle APEX is already installed on top of Oracle Autonomous Database:

Navigate to Development at Oracle Cloud

You become to the APEX login folio .

Log in as an ADMIN user – click Sign In to Administration . The purpose is to create an Noon user. So you will use it to develop your awarding.

APEX login page

APEX requires you to create a workspace with a shared work area. Multiple developers can work there when edifice their applicationŃ–:

APEX requires you to create a workspace with a shared work area

Click on Create Workspace . Yous demand to provide the Democratic Database user.

Create Workspace at Oracle APEX

Confirm by clicking the Create Workspace button.

Click the Create Workspace button at APEX

Create an Noon Programmer

Navigate to the Manage Workspaces menu and choose Manage Developers and Users under the Workspace Actions department:

Create an APEX developer

A defended page appears. You will see the two default users in that location:

  • ADMIN user is on the INTERNAL workspace
  • DEMO user is on the DEMO workspace (yous created the workspace in the previous stride).

Both users are of the Workspace Administrator business relationship type.

 Workspace Administrator account type

Click Create User in the top-right corner. The Create / Edit User folio appears. Hither, you have to create a developer who volition be assigned to develop the Upload/Download application.

Use the following details:

User Attributes

  • Username: dev_1
  • Email: you should enter a valid electronic mail
  • First Name: DEV 1

Account Privileges

  • Workspace: DEMO (this workspace created)
  • Default Schema: DEMO (the database user schema in Democratic Database)
  • User is an administrator: No
  • User is a programmer: Yes
  • Go along other attributes equally default

Password (For authentication confronting workspace user account repository only)

  • Countersign to utilize access Workspace
  • Password: Oracle#202105 (Password must satisfy the Oracle Database password policy)
  • Confirm Password: Oracle#202105
  • Require Alter of Countersign on Offset Use: No (this option would require you to change the password in the commencement-fourth dimension login)
 Create / Edit User page at APEX

Click Create User , and you can run into the new user in the list. The account blazon of the new user is Developer .

The account type of the new user is Developer

Click on the ADMIN contour icon on the pinnacle-right corner and Sign Out .

Permit'southward try to access APEX with the new dev_1 user nosotros've merely created.

On the login folio, provide the workspace assigned to your account, enter your username and password. In this examination case, log in with dev_1 and password Oracle#202105:

APEX login page

You lot can run into the home folio (the Developer account type). Now yous are gear up to build your application.

Install Upload and Download Application

The Noon platform has some pre-built applications, such as plug-in. You tin re-employ them speedily.

Click on App Gallery and get the card. It offers a listing of prebuilt apps (sample apps) bachelor in APEX:

Install, Upload and Download application

Click on Sample File Upload and Download > Install App to add this application to your workspace:

Add the application to your APEX workspace

If you are authorized successfully, click Adjacent to install this app.

Install the app

Click on the Run icon to execute the application.

Now, let'south attempt to upload a sample file with the installed application.

On the left panel, create a new project (e.grand., My Upload Project) by clicking on the plus icon:

Create a new project

Fill the mandatory fields:

Fill the mandatory fields

The projection is created, and you can upload files. Navigate to the Home page and click on the Plus icon on the Contempo Files panel.

Navigate to the Home page and click on the Plus icon on the Recent Files panel

The Upload folio appears. Scan to the file yous want to upload and click Add File :

Browse to the file you want to upload and click Add File

Annotation: The file is uploaded and stored in the BLOB column of Autonomous Database.

The file is uploaded and stored in the BLOB column of Autonomous Database

Let's access your Autonomous Database instance and query the data. You will see two tables created there:

  • EBA_DEMO_FILES to store the data of files you uploaded
  • EBA_DEMO_FILE_PROJECT to store the information of your projects
 Autonomous Database instance

Conclusion

Oracle Noon uses the database encapsulated simple metadata-driven architecture. It provides fast data access, top operation, and scalability out of the box.

With APEX, you can develop and deploy your application anywhere with minimum programming skills. APEX too provides the prebuilt set of sample applications – you just need to install them to beginning using them.

Last modified: September 23, 2021

gamblenerld1970.blogspot.com

Source: https://codingsight.com/create-an-upload-download-application-with-oracle-apex/

0 Response to "Data Upload and Download to Cloud Symbol"

Post a Comment

Iklan Atas Artikel

Iklan Tengah Artikel 1

Iklan Tengah Artikel 2

Iklan Bawah Artikel